## Design and Build: Ultra-Light Without the Fragile Feel


At just 159 grams, the Sony Xperia 10 V is officially the world's lightest 5G smartphone. Pick it up and the first thing you notice is how effortlessly it sits in the hand — no wrist fatigue, no awkward balancing act. Yet Sony hasn't sacrificed build quality. The matte plastic back is surprisingly premium, resists fingerprints, and won't shatter if you drop it without a case.
The 6.1-inch OLED display is protected by Gorilla Glass Victus, and the phone carries an IP68 rating, meaning it survives dust and a dip in water. For a mid-range device, that's an exceptional level of durability.
## Key Features Under the Hood
The Xperia 10 V strikes an impressive balance between weight, battery, and everyday performance. It's powered by the Snapdragon 695 chipset with 6GB of RAM — not a gaming powerhouse, but more than adequate for social media, streaming, navigation, and light multitasking.
Here is a quick look at the standout specs:
- **Battery:** 5,000mAh — enormous for a 159g phone. Expect approximately 34 hours of video playback on a single charge. This is the phone's killer feature.
- **Display:** 6.1-inch FHD+ OLED with Triluminos display technology. Sony's expertise in screens (inherited from their TV division) means rich colours and deep blacks.
- **Camera:** Triple rear cameras — 48MP wide, 8MP ultra-wide, and 8MP telephoto. Sony's camera app includes the same manual controls found on the flagship Xperia 1 series.
- **Audio:** Dual front-facing stereo speakers with Sony's audio processing. The 3.5mm headphone jack is present with High-Resolution Audio support.
## Who Is the Xperia 10 V Actually For?
The Xperia 10 V is for anyone who prioritises battery life and portability above all else. If you are a frequent traveller, a student walking between classes, or someone who simply hates carrying a charger, this phone will easily get you through two days of moderate use.
It's also an excellent choice for audiophiles on a budget, thanks to the 3.5mm jack and Hi-Res Audio certification — a rare combination in 2026.
If you need raw gaming performance or the absolute best camera, the Galaxy A series or Pixel 7A may offer better value. But for sheer endurance and pocketability, the Xperia 10 V is unmatched.
